The Little Clinic is located right inside your neighborhood grocery store. Our board-certified nurse practitioners and physician assistants can diagnose and treat minor illnesses, administer vaccines, provide physicals and much more! Plus, we are open 7 days a week and we take most insurance plans.

Frequently Asked Questions About The Little Clinic
What is The Little Clinic and where is it located?
The Little Clinic is a medical clinic located inside a neighborhood grocery store at 1095 S Main St, Centerville, OH 45458, USA.
What medical services does The Little Clinic provide?
The clinic offers diagnosis and treatment for minor illnesses, vaccines, physicals, and more, staffed by board-certified nurse practitioners and physician assistants.
What are the operating hours of The Little Clinic?
Monday to Friday, 8:30 AM to 7:30 PM; Saturday, 8:30 AM to 5:00 PM; Sunday, 9:30 AM to 4:00 PM.
Do I need an appointment for COVID-19 testing at The Little Clinic?
Yes, COVID-19 testing requires an appointment and pre-screening can be set up via The Little Clinic's website.
What insurance plans are accepted at The Little Clinic?
The clinic accepts most insurance plans and also accepts prompt pay for COVID-19 testing.
What payment methods are accepted at The Little Clinic?
The clinic accepts American Express, Cash, Check, Discover, Mastercard, and Visa.
Is The Little Clinic accessible for wheelchair users?
Yes, The Little Clinic has wheelchair accessible entrances, parking, and restrooms.
